Detailed description

The primary goal is to quantify cerebrospinal fluid (CSF) volume, diffusion characteristics and mechanical properties of brain tissue at two states of arousal: 1. Resting, awake state 2. During sleep with low-dose intravenous infusion of dexmedetomidine (titrated to a Bispectral index (BIS) of 60-70)

Interventions

TypeNameDescription
DRUGDexmedetomidineThe standard dosing of 1mcg/kg will be implemented over 10 minutes followed by a maintenance infusion of 0.2-1.0 titrated to a the target BIS (60-70) during the 20 minutes prior to MRI.
